Summary:
A photograph of an image of a woman with a triangular slice where her eyes should be, a two-page aerial shot of a forest, a train coming straight at us: Bertrand Fleuret's artist's book Landmasses and Railways juxtaposes such enigmatic and striking black-and-white images to create a pleasantly unsettling, difficult-to-decipher narrative. Edited by photographer Jason Fulford, whose own influential publications are helping to define a new generation of photobooks, this exquisitely designed 200-page volume is dreamlike, taking us on a journey through rural and urban landscapes, construction and decay, chaos and clarity. Bertrand Fleuret, currently based in Berlin, was born in Versailles in 1969.

Summary:
Born in Paris in 1972, Rémy Marlot's work associates the concepts of nature and culture in his work, around the issues of the urban landscape, the garden, dreams and night time. Since 1999, he has oriented his work Alongside his photography, his developing videographic work establishes a dialogue between these two media. Rémy Marlot's work is exhibited in Europe, the United States and Japan.

Summary:
Hong Kong is often cited as the city with the most high-rise buildings and one of the highest population densities in the world. Photographer John Fung’s project ‘One Square Foot’ challenges the viewer to seek a different appreciation of the open, geometric abstraction and complexity of spatial relationships in our concrete cities. The high-rise buildings of Hong Kong are depicted through a complex series of multiple-exposure photographs that are aesthetically intriguing and that triumph over the emptiness of purposeless congestion. Martin Roemers: relics of the cold war

Summary:
The Cold War is over, but its traces linger. Dutch documentary photographer Martin Roemers (born 1962) traveled through formerly hostile countries on both sides of the line, descending into underground tunnels and abandoned control centers, making images that remind us that this past remains vividly present.

Summary:
Andreas Schmidt captures clear-sighted images on his nighttime rambles through the City of London — the historical heart of the city and one of the world’s financial centers. As was the case in his photobook Las Vegas, which dealt with another glittering, superficial world, here he also documents the seductive glamour of urban financial palaces while never losing sight of their inhuman exorbitance. Although hundreds of thousands of people work in the City, its dimensions are not human. Everything is oversized, made of steel, glass, and marble, and decorated with mindless ornamental elements. Only emergency exits or indoor plants are of normal size, and they look absurd next to everything else. Empty lobbies, conference rooms, and endless corridors conform to corporate design, but primarily emanate power and coldness. As the cover of the book attests, the venerable Bank of England long ago began fitting itself out with enormous grandeur : the Neoclassical façade by Sir John Soane (1828) was regarded as an insurmountable barrier for unauthorized persons.

Summary:
This book is the long awaited survey of 25 years of Paul Graham photography, 1981-2006, to coincide with a large scale touring European museum exhibition. Graham was the first photographer to unite contemporary colour photography with the classic genre of social documentary.

Summary:
Eikoh Hosoe's Kamaitachi, a classic and groundbreaking body of work, was originally released in 1969 as a limited-edition photobook of one thousand copies. A unique collaboration between photographer Eikoh Hosoe and Tatsumi Hijikata, the founder of ankoku butoh dance, the work documents their visit to a farming village in northern Japan and the improvisational performance that resulted, made with the participation of local villagers and inspired by the legend of kamaitachi, a weasel-like demon who haunts the rice fields and slashes those he encounters with a sickle. In 2005, in close consultation with the artist, Aperture released a limited-edition facsimile in homage to the original. This 2009 edition now includes four never-before-published images from the classic Kamaitachi series and a new text by Japanese scholar Donald Keene, as well as essays by Eikoh Hosoe and Suzo Takiguchi. This edition was painstakingly reworked by graphic artist Ikko Tanaka, designer of the original volume, shortly before his death.

Summary:
Un'opera che raccoglie e cataloga tutti i libri fotografici di Gabriele Basilico, coprendo un'attività quasi trentennale, dal 1978 al 2006. Ogni libro è presentato con la copertina originale, i dati bibliografici e una foto tratta dal volume. Pagina dopo pagina, foto dopo foto, salta all'occhio la ricchezza e la varietà dei soggetti scelti da Basilico per i suoi scatti: dalle periferie milanesi della fine degli anni Settanta, alle balere emiliane, alle industrie e ai porti, fino ad arrivare al centro di Beirut nei primi anni Novanta e alla nuova anima di Berlino. Questo libro si pone come uno strumento utile a studiosi ma anche a semplici appassionati di grande fotografia ed è un'occasione speciale per fare il punto sulla carriera di un fotografo che con i suoi scatti ha costruito la nostra percezione del paesaggio contemporaneo.

Summary:
A precarious balance between the human and natural worlds comes to the fore in Scott McFarland's large-scale photographs of meticulously maintained private gardens. These gorgeous yet exacting images reveal the precarious balance between human and natural worlds and how photography’s link to reality is both true and fabricated. This publication explores how McFarland manipulates the photograph to depict a state of harmony and peacefulness that borders on artificiality. Scott McFarland lives and works in Vancouver. This publication is the first substantial overview of his work.

Summary:
A pioneering conceptual and multidisciplinary artist, Antin has lately turned her attention to creating enormous photo-realist settings based on Greek and Roman history and mythology. These works, often displayed as two-page spreads, are both comic and psychologically complex re-enactments from literature: Roman Allegories, Last Days of Pompeii, and Helen s Odyssey.
